Combinatorial Set Theory and Inner Models

E. Schimmerling
Additional contact information
E. Schimmerling: University of California, Irvine, Department of Mathematics

A chapter in Set Theory, 1998, pp 207-212 from Springer

Abstract: Abstract Core model theory has lead to a new hierarchy of square principles. In the other direction, various combinatorial principles have been used to construct core models with Woodin cardinals.
